T SSubject: Transform multiple node values to one node value

I need to transform the following XML

<root>
<person>
<name>Name-ABC</name>
<complete-address>
<address-line type="Apt#">10</address-line>
<address-line type="street">Wall St</address-line>
<address-line type="city">New York</address-line>
<address-line type="state">NY</address-line>
<address-line type="Zip">10005</address-line>
</complete-address>
</person>
<person>
.
.
</person>
</root>

to

<root>
<person>
<name>Name-ABC</name>
<complete-address>
<address-line type="Apt#">10</address-line>
<address-line type="street">Wall St</address-line>
<complete-address>
<address>City=New York;State=NY;Zip=10005</address>
</person>
</root>

Appreciate any help in providing a solution using XSL

James DurningSubject: Transform multiple node values to one node value

<xsl:template match="complete-address">
<xsl:copy>
<xsl:copy-of select="address-line[@type='Apt#' or @type='street']"/>
</xsl:copy>
<address>
<xsl:apply-templates select="address-line[not(@type='Apt#' or @type='street')]"/>
</address>
</xsl:template>
<xsl:template match="address-line">
<xsl:value-of select="@type">
<xsl:text>=</xsl:text>
<xsl:value-of select="."/>
<xsl:if test="not(last())">
<xsl:text>;</xsl:text>
</xsl:if>
</xsl:template>
